Maya Urban Towns is a small-scale community of stacked townhomes from LIV Communities, set along Bramalea Road in northeast Brampton. With 57 homes rising three storeys, it's an intimate development rather than a sprawling one.
Construction is complete and the project is now selling, giving buyers the rare chance to see and move into a finished home rather than waiting on renderings.

Bramalea Road is a key north-south route through this side of Brampton, connecting residents toward the city's major corridors and beyond. The area is broadly served by Highway 410, which links north Brampton to Mississauga and the wider Highway 401 network, while Brampton Transit routes and nearby GO Transit services on the Kitchener line offer connections for commuters heading into the Greater Toronto Area.

For pre-construction condominium purchases in Ontario, buyers are protected by a 10-day cooling-off period under the Condominium Act, during which they can cancel their agreement. This statutory right applies specifically to new condos; freehold and townhome purchases follow the standard agreement of purchase and sale process, so review your contract carefully and consider legal advice before signing.

Homes are priced from $599,990 to $729,990 CAD. Pricing can change between releases, so confirm current availability and figures with the builder.
Maya Urban Towns is a collection of stacked townhomes, standing three storeys tall, with 57 homes in total. Interior sizes range from roughly 1,368 to 1,687 square feet.
The development is located at 11613 Bramalea Road in Brampton, within Ontario's Peel Region, along a key north-south route in the northeast part of the city.
Maya Urban Towns is built by LIV Communities, a homebuilder active in the Greater Toronto Area and Peel Region.
Construction is complete, with estimated occupancy in October 2024. Because the project is finished, move-in-ready homes may be available — confirm timing directly with the builder.
